Well VBA is the only option for those of use using the TIFF exploit and GTA (2.0-2.6), since as of now the PSP GBA's newer version doesn't work on our firmware, leaving us with just VBA.

You can load them in ZIP format, so yes you can (use the option for zip when compressin with winrar if you choose to do so, not in RAR format). If you plan on playing the roms at this slow of a speed, then by all means keep going, but if not i suggest you wait until the emulator is at a later version with better functionality.
I haven't tried using Zip so best of luck to you on other roms, but as far as the original format goes, I have tried a few games and it seems to load fine. Maybe you just have a corrupt rom or it is not supported by the emulator in this early of a stage. May i suggest the Worms World Party? Seems to run fine on mine.
